31A-6b-203. Filing new or changed guaranteed asset protection waiver.
A person required to be registered under Section 31A-6b-201 shall submit to the commissioner at least 30 days before the day on which the person issues, markets, sells, offers to sell, or otherwise provides a guaranteed asset protection waiver in this state:
(1)a change to a term of a guaranteed asset protection waiver previously submitted to the commissioner under this chapter; or
(2)a guaranteed asset protection waiver that has not previously been submitted to the commissioner under this chapter.
Enacted by Chapter 274 , 2010 General Session
